## Description

**Agentium: User Agent Switcher** is a versatile Chrome extension that enables users to control the user agent identity reported by their browser. This functionality allows you to view the mobile version of websites on a desktop or emulate other popular browsers. The extension offers a quick selection from a default list of popular user agents and supports adding custom ones, all within a simple and clean user interface.

Agentium is open-source software released under the Apache 2.0 License. Developers and users are welcome to contribute or adapt the tool via its GitHub repository, enhancing its customization and versatility. Whether for web development, testing, or privacy needs, Agentium offers a straightforward approach to user agent switching.
